Bismarck Tower

The in belongs to a series of towers that were built in honor of Otto von Bismarck, the first German chancellor. It is located on the .

The Schlossbergturm or Castle Hill Tower is a 35 m high observation tower on Castle Hill on the edge of the historic Altstadt of . is situated 230 metres northeast of Bismarck Tower.
